The area of a rectangle can be found by multiplying the length by the width a rectangular postage stamp has a length of nine-tenths inch and a width of five-sixths inch what is the area of the stamp in square inches?

area=9/10 times 5/6 area = 45/60 area=0.75in^2
or\[\frac{ 9 }{ 10 }*\frac{ 5 }{ 6 }\]the 5 would cancel with the 10, making the 10 a 2, and 3 goes into both 9 and 6, leaving\[\frac{ 3 }{ 4 }"^{2}\]Coouldn't get that to say "inches squared" so I did that.
